- 博客(86)
- 资源 (5)
- 收藏
- 关注
原创 离线安装 Supervisor
因为须要安装meld组件,因此须要至少python2.6以上版本,因而咱们先安装python2.6,而后再安装supervisor。配置表示包括/etc/supervisor/conf.d/的全部conf文件tomcat。将安装包中的supervisord文件拷到/etc/init.d/中app。杀死tomcat进程,查看是否进程自动重启以及日志状况服务器。日志查看开机启动配置状况code。二、安装supervisor。4.安装Supervisor。三、配置supervisor。加入开机启动rest。
2024-05-30 11:26:15 723
原创 liunx telnet 安装
安装:http://www.rpmfind.net/linux/centos/7.9.2009/updates/x86_64/Packages/telnet-server-0.17-66.el7.x86_64.rpm。安装:http://www.rpmfind.net/linux/centos/7.9.2009/updates/x86_64/Packages/telnet-0.17-66.el7.x86_64.rpm。(3)最后执行如下命令安装服务端:</p>(1)执行如下telnet;
2024-05-30 11:11:20 1451
原创 mongodb 编码格式 Detected BSON
如果有非UTF-8编码的数据用mongo扩展可以读出来,用mongodb扩展读可能会抛异常(Detected corrupt BSON data), 这种一方面需要进行数据修复,另一方面需要堵住入口,避免出现此类问题。这种问题一般是在客户端发送的消息、邮件里有特殊字符导致。mongo扩展里这部分是在增删改查的接口里设置(insert,update,remove等),但是在mongodb扩展里,在MongoDBDriverWriteConcern里指定,然后作为executeBulkWrite的参数。
2024-05-30 11:04:54 438
原创 JS禁用F12审查元素,屏蔽右键菜单,复制,粘贴,剪切
注入恶意JS等等,这种情况避免也不难,虽然还能看到一部分H5源码,但是无法修改。这种很适合小说网站,毕竟版权珍贵,被别人随意copy走内容就不好了。审查元素的情况下,大家都可以随机更改一部分页面的代码,一、屏蔽F12 审查元素。
2023-04-21 09:15:29 598
原创 js代码实现复制网页内指定的内容
js自动复制输入框内的内容,只需要用 select() 方法来选择 input 元素内的内容,进行拷贝即可,过程非常的简单,可以参考下面的示例代码!上面的JS复制DIV内容的操作过程,只是模拟了用户手动复制输入框内容的操作,实现的过程可以参考下面的解析!2、使用 input 元素的 select() 方法来选中 input 内的所有内容!1、复制函数中新建立了一个 input 元素,并将要拷贝的内容写放到元素中去。4:移动新建的 input 元素!
2023-04-08 18:21:48 1382
原创 scrapy AttributeError: module ‘collections‘ has no attribute ‘MutableSet‘
scrapy AttributeError: module 'collections' has no attribute 'MutableSet'
2023-02-03 11:23:53 1962 1
原创 ThinkPHP6 think-queue 消息队列(延迟队列)
任务类不需继承任何类,如果这个类只有一个任务,那么就只需要提供一个fire方法就可以了,如果有多个小任务,就写多个方法,下面发布任务的时候会有区别。多任务可以写在一个文件里面,也可以分开多个文件写入,多个文件的时候,发送指定对应的执行类。两种,具体的可选参数可以输入命令加 --help 查看。还有个可选的任务失败执行的方法。(发布任务时自定义的数据)(发布任务时自定义的数据)每个方法会传入两个参数。(当前的任务对象) 和。
2022-12-15 14:03:01 1632 1
原创 SQLSTATE[22001]: String data, right truncated: 1406 Data too long for column
原因是:插入字段长度超过设定的长度。在my.ini里找到。
2022-12-10 14:04:33 5442
原创 liunx系统下安装crontab
2)crontabs 软件包是用来安装、卸装、或列举用来驱动 cron 守护进程的表格的程序。正常情况下需要先执行$:apt-get upgrade 进行升级。1)vixie-cron 软件包是 cron 的主程序;
2022-12-09 10:00:46 2402
原创 Swoole 编译安装
1、下载源码2、解压3、配置php.ini注意:不知道 php.ini 所在目录时,您可以通过运行 确定。编译安装成功后,修改php.ini加入4、查看swoole版本
2022-12-05 10:40:09 246
原创 编译 Redis 安装
1、目录结构2、编译安装注意:make完后目录下会出现编译后的redis服务程序redis-server,还有用于测试的客户端程序redis-cli3、启动
2022-12-05 10:28:55 312
原创 Nginx 1.22 编译安装
1、安装依赖包注意:安装过程中如还有其他安装需要安装也直接 进行安装2、下载安装包3、创建用户与组4、创建目录5、解压文件6、编译nginx7、让系统识别nginx的操作命令、检查配置文件,启动Nginx服务8、访问服务9、在 配置nginx识别php文件
2022-12-05 10:23:47 2037
原创 Mysql5.7源码安装
1、目录定义2、下载二进制安装包3、创建用户组创建一个用户组mysql和一个不能执行shell登录的用户mysql4、解压安装5、给相关权限6、配置
2022-12-05 09:52:15 247
原创 PHP8 源码编译安装
1、源码下载2、解压3、编译安装注意:安装路径可通过–prefix=自定义4、设置环境变量修改/etc/profile文件使其永久性生效,并对所有系统用户生效,在文件末尾加上如下代码最后:执行 命令source /etc/profile或 执行点命令使其修改生效;执行完可通过echo $PATH命令查看是否添加成功。5、配置php.ini文件查看php.ini 配置地址,然后把php.ini-development复制到对应目录下并命名为php.ini注:安装依赖如果安装过程中失败,需要
2022-12-05 09:48:51 876
原创 VirtualBox 安装CentOs6.8 无法上网问题和无法yum 安装文件的问题
1、VirtualBox安装CentOs7,安装完成后,使用ping命令发现无法上网2、解决方式先关闭虚拟机,可以使用命令关闭,也可以手动强制关闭3、配置以太网4、启动Linux虚拟机,使用root用户登录进入系统6、编辑网卡配置7、重启网卡8、验证上网功能,已经能正常上网1、解决办法在/etc/yum.conf文件中,添加以下一行内容即可。2、执行yum install vim
2022-12-03 23:16:23 1289
原创 centos7.9编译安装libzip-1.9.2 和 cmake 3.23.0
指定 cmake 软链接这样可以在全局使用它,你可以把/usr/local/cmake/bin/cmake 指定到/usr/bin/cmake 或者 /usr/local/bin/cmake, 我们推荐使用/usr/local/bin/cmake,具体的请去百度了解一下/usr/bin 和 usr/local/bin的区别。方法2也是通过设置pkg_config_path 环境变量方法,但是是永久有效,不受重启影响,先看pkg_config_path的值有没有生效,没有的话就添加。3、修改php.ini。
2022-12-02 16:52:09 3716 1
原创 利用phpspreadsheet导出Excel图表(折线图、饼状图、柱状图)
【代码】利用phpspreadsheet导出Excel图表(折线图、饼状图、柱状图)
2022-12-01 17:44:17 687
uniapp H5集成微信JS支付和阿里云支付,亲测能用,放心下载
2020-08-03
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人